#2c6be2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c6be2 is composed of 17.3% red, 42%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 219.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#2c6be2 color hex could be obtained by blending #58d6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2c6be2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c6be2 has RGB values of R:44, G:107,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2911202.

Shades and Tints of #2c6be2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060d is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c6be2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f858f is the less saturated color, while #1062fe is the most saturated one.
